I bought these fins before a recent scuba diving trip to Belize. I was a little skeptical for two reasons; price and looks. The price is higher than most fins I have seen on the market and frankly the fins look "high-tech" like the type of fin a new diver with more money than skill would use and spend the whole boat ride talking about. So, I went online to check the reviews and found a couple of good ones from self proclaimed cynical divers who gave the fins great ratings. With my trip quickly approaching I decided to go all in and order the fins with the optional spring straps. I got yellow.Now before I say how great these fins were for me, I have to admit that the fins I have been diving with for 20 years were nothing to write home about. They were a pair of USDivers "Blades" - a very basic fin that always seemed to give me leg cramps and weren't very effective when I needed to swim hard. Usually swimming hard just gave me more cramps. By comparison, the Auqabionic Warp 1 fins were amazing. It took me one or two dives to get used to them, but after that they really performed well. I tried every form of kicking I could think of including power kicks, frog kicks, turning kicks, just flexing my ankles, etc. The fins did all of these great with no calf cramps. The thing that probably impressed me the most was how much power I could get out of them without sucking down a lot of air. A couple of hard kicks and I could move quite a ways without feeling the need to breath heavy. I started out using the adjustable straps that came with the fins and they worked fine. After about 6 dives I changed to the spring straps and liked them better. They are just easier to get on and off and for me the fins feel better secured to my feet. The only thing about the fins that took me a little while to get used to was the flexing of the inner web when kicking softly in low current or drift type dives. You can feel the slight "thump" when the web flexes and at first I thought my fins were contacting rock or coral (one thing I am very careful not to do!). But after awhile you get used the feel and can distinguish between the flexing and actual fin contact. It's a minor thing and actually I thought the feeling was kind of cool after I got used to it.Net, I would highly recommend these. I have never felt more in control under water.
